Viva! Victorio & Lucchino
Fragrance Story
Viva! by Victorio & Lucchino is a Floral Fruity fragrance for women. Viva! was launched in 2015. Top notes are Bergamot, Mandarin Orange, Pineapple and Water Fruit; middle notes are Lily-of-the-Valley, Peony, Violet and Pink Pepper; base notes are Amber, Sandalwood, Patchouli and Musk.
